This is my new-to-me 1973 Johnson 20. I traded a 1982 15hp long shaft that I wasn't using for this short shaft 20hp. It is mechanically sound but looks pretty rough. As you can see someone painted it very poorly with this gross green color.

 

    04/29/26

    I sanded it a little today while I was waiting on some carburetor parts to soak. (I hate sanding) I just used a little electric palm sander and got the big flat areas. I will have to go back and actually use sandpaper to get the rest when I have some time.  Im planning on repainting it to match my late 50s modified vhull and just use my 15 as a back up motor.
